Is LeBron James a snitch, or did he just stand up for himself?

Yesterday night (Wednesday, Nov. 24th), the Los Angeles Lakers took on the Indiana Pacers in Indianapolis. While many fans are focusing on LeBron James‘ high-ranking performance throughout the match, others are honing in on another incident from the game.

At one point during overtime, LeBron James took a referee by the arm and led him to a pair of courtside Pacers fans. After pointing out a man and woman, LeBron can vaguely be heard saying:

“This one right f**king here.”

One of LeBron‘s teammates, Russell Westbrook, then enters the frame and seemingly sides with him. Immediately afterwards, the two Pacers fans are kicked out.

After the game concluded, LeBron James addressed the matter by saying:

“Nothing is uncomfortable for me, but there’s a difference between cheering on your home faithful, booing opponents and things of that nature or not wanting opponents to be successful. And then there’s moments where it goes outside the line, where I see gestures and words. And that shouldn’t be tolerated in our game from nobody. A fan should never say that to a player, and that’s it.”

While it’s currently unclear what exactly the ejected couple had said, there are some rumors circulating that it had to do with LeBron‘s teenage son, LeBron “Bronny” James Jr. 

Since the matter, fans have been fairly divided over the situation. It’s also worth noting that “LeSnitch” and “Karen” both began trending on Twitter due to the incident, and you can see what some users had to say down below:
